How to Run an EXE File at the Windows Command Prompt

Web12 de feb. de 2015 · Another way which is quite useful if the path to the .exe file is a complicated one: Open a Command Prompt window and just drag the .exe file into the window. The full path to the .exe file will be pasted into the Command Prompt window and you just have to press Enter. There is no need to cd into any paths. Web1 de may. de 2011 · You need to mark shell scripts as executable to run them from the file manager: Right click on your .sh file and select Properties: In the Permissions tab, check Allow executing file as program: Close the Properties window and double-click the file. Web6 de dic. de 2024 · Try identifying the file in question by typing file nameOfProgram to see if you get ELF 32-bit or ELF 64-bit as output. If it tells you that it’s an ELF 64-bit binary and you received i686 as output from the arch command, then there’s no way you can reasonably run it on your machine.
